hey guys i just got a brand new coolant sensor from holden for my VP.......was just wondering EXACTLY where abouts it is and is it just a "rip old one out and screw new one in" procedure? and will the car drop much coolant during the swap over..........cheers!!
Check that other thread u just posted in. It wont drip much, say 100ml if ur quick. Its just a 15mm i think, unsrew it then screw in the new one, n clip on the plug. Also take note of where the wireing harness is routed, it took me about 20min to figure out how to get it the right way around soo it all fitted like b4, and make sure you take off the neg terminal, it could arc off the Alt + cable to the block if u dont.
is this coolant sensor as in the sensor for the temp gauge in the car? situated under the alternator?
there are 2 under there, on the left is the temp sender (for guage) on the right is coolant sensor for ECU
